2014-11-17 1 views
0

어제 현재 이미지 파일을 이미지 폴더에서 올바르게 가져 와서 문자 모델을 작성했지만 display.newImageRect를 호출하면 대부분 검은 색 사각형이 나타납니다. 이 결함은 iOS에서만 발생하며 안드로이드 또는 시뮬레이터에서는 발생하지 않습니다. 어떤 제안?최신 Corona SDK 빌드로 iOS에 이미지 파일을로드하는 중 오류가 발생했습니다.

이미지로드와 관련된 코드는 변경되지 않았습니다.

코로나 : v2014.2393 OSX : 10.9.5 엑스 코드 : 6.1

이 이미지 또는 성격의 아무것도를로드 할 수 없습니다 것을 나타냅니다 콘솔에는 메시지가없고, 문제가 있다는 것입니다 그것은 시뮬레이터와 안드로이드에서 작동합니다. 그러나 응용 프로그램이 iOS 용으로 제작 된 경우 문자 모델을 작성하고 대부분의 이미지를로드 할 때 오류가 발생하지만 다른 장면 (훨씬 덜 복잡한 장면)에서 똑같은 모듈을 사용하면 궁금합니다. 사용 된 텍스처 메모리는 약 15MB입니다. 그게 오류의 원인이 될지 모르겠지만, 나는 그것이 확실하지 않다는 것을 확신합니다. 제가 말했듯이, 흥미로운 것은 2 일 전의 빌드가 여전히 작동하고 이미지를 잘로드한다는 것입니다.

명확성을 위해 모든 이미지 파일은 PNG입니다.

업데이트 : 이전에 작동했던 이전 빌드에서 동일한 버그가 발생합니다. 따라서 iOS 또는 적어도 iOS 8 최신 버전과의 호환성 문제 일 수 있습니다.

XCode 및 Corona의 이전 버전을 사용하면 이전 버전의 응용 프로그램을 빌드하는 경우에만 작동하는 것으로 보입니다. 또한 의도적으로 파일 이름을 잘못 입력하면 다른 오류가 발생합니다. 따라서 이미지가 발견되지 않는 것은 아닙니다. 다른 컴퓨터에서 작업중인 빌드에서 동일한 이미지 파일을 사용하더라도 결함이 발생하지 않습니다. 또한 이미지로드를 위해 모듈을 이전 빌드로 복사하는 것을 옮기지 않습니다.

저는 심각하게 당황하고 있습니다.

+0

이미지의 철자, 대소 문자 및 확장자를 확인하십시오. –

+0

있습니다. 모두 일관성이 있지만 입력에 감사드립니다. – user2704305

답변

0

이 문제를 확실하게 재현 할 수있는 경우 Corona forums 또는 report a bug을 묻는 것이 좋습니다.

+0

문제가 처음 발생했을 때 포럼에 게시했습니다. 이것은 실제로 같은 질문을 재현 한 것입니다. 그들은 버전 번호를 물어 봤고 이후 침묵했습니다. – user2704305

관련 문제